Dagmarteatret 1881.jpg 544 × 350; 67 KB. WebDagmar (born Virginia Ruth Egnor, November 29, 1921 – October 9, 2001) was an American actress, model and television personality of the 1950s. As a statuesque, busty blonde, she became the first major female star of television, receiving much press coverage during that decade. She was an actress and singer who parlayed her dumb blonde act ...

WebDagmar Manzel (born 1 September 1958) is a German actress. She has appeared in more than 80 films and television shows since 1979. ... In 1983 she moved to the Deutsches Theater in Berlin, which became her artistic home.
